Waterspout Spotted Off Clearwater's Sand Key Park (patch.com) — A dramatic waterspout formed about 10 miles off Clearwater's Sand Key Park on Saturday afternoon, prompting warnings from Clearwater police for beachgoers to seek shelter as storms moved through. Meteorologists reported the waterspout persisted and later regenerated offshore, while boaters maneuvered to avoid it and officials emphasized staying off the water and sand during such hazardous conditions.

Clearwater Police Launch Street Safety Campaign To Protect Walkers And Cyclists (tampafp.com) — Clearwater drivers, walkers, and cyclists will see more police along Gulf-to-Bay, Drew, Court, Missouri and other busy corridors as a new safety campaign ramps up through May 2027. Funded by a state-backed contract, the High Visibility Enforcement effort targets crashes involving pedestrians and bicyclists, emphasizing education but allowing citations when needed to curb dangerous behavior.

Murder trial for Tarpon Springs plastic surgeon accused in death of Largo attorney underway (tampabay28.com) — A high‑profile murder trial is underway in Clearwater, where Tarpon Springs plastic surgeon Tomas Kosowski is being tried before a judge, without a jury, in the 2023 disappearance and alleged killing of Largo attorney Steven Cozzi. Prosecutors spent the first day outlining their case and calling colleagues, friends, and family who described Cozzi's character and detailed tensions over earlier medical billing litigation.

Tickets on sale for 2026 Skechers World Champions Cup in Clearwater (wftv.com) — Clearwater residents can now snag tickets for the 2026 Skechers World Champions Cup, returning Dec. 3-6 to Feather Sound Country Club. The PGA TOUR Champions event will feature U.S., European, and International teams, with affordable grounds passes, premium hospitality options, and free admission for kids with adults, plus complimentary tickets for eligible military members and first responders.
